1. Functional Strength

Functional strength, the ability to perform everyday movements with ease and efficiency, lies at the heart of the principle of simple, repetitive tasks leading to physical fitness. This type of strength is not solely about lifting heavy weights in a gym setting; it’s about developing practical strength applicable to real-life situations. Consider the act of chopping wood: it engages multiple muscle groups simultaneously, requiring coordination, balance, and power. Similarly, carrying water demands core stability, grip strength, and endurance. These activities, while seemingly mundane, build a type of strength that translates directly into improved performance in daily life, from lifting groceries to playing with children.

The emphasis on functional strength offers a significant advantage over isolated strength training often seen in conventional gyms. While isolating specific muscles can be beneficial for certain goals, it often neglects the interconnectedness of the human body. Functional movements, on the other hand, mimic natural movement patterns, leading to more balanced muscle development and reduced risk of injury. This translates to greater overall fitness and resilience, preparing individuals for the physical demands of daily life and promoting long-term physical well-being. For example, a farmer who regularly lifts hay bales develops functional strength that improves their ability to perform other physically demanding tasks, unlike someone who solely focuses on bicep curls.

Developing functional strength through consistent, natural movements offers a sustainable and practical approach to fitness. This approach fosters a more integrated and robust physique, promoting not just physical strength but also improved mobility, balance, and overall well-being. It moves beyond the aesthetic pursuit of a particular body shape and emphasizes the importance of building a body capable of performing the tasks life demands, contributing to a healthier and more fulfilling life. The challenge lies in recognizing the value of these seemingly simple activities and incorporating them into a modern lifestyle often dominated by sedentary habits.

3. Full-body engagement

Full-body engagement forms a cornerstone of functional strength development, distinguishing it from isolated exercises often seen in modern fitness routines. Unlike isolating specific muscles, activities reminiscent of chopping wood and carrying water necessitate the coordinated activation of multiple muscle groups across the entire body. This integrated approach yields a more balanced physique, enhances functional movement patterns, and contributes significantly to overall fitness and resilience.

  • Compound Movements

    Chopping wood and carrying water exemplify compound movements, actions that engage multiple muscle groups simultaneously. The act of swinging an axe recruits muscles in the arms, shoulders, back, core, and legs, fostering coordinated strength development. Similarly, carrying water requires core stabilization, grip strength, and lower body engagement. These compound movements, unlike isolated exercises such as bicep curls or leg extensions, promote functional strength applicable to diverse physical demands.

  • Core Activation

    A stable core is essential for efficient force transfer and injury prevention. Both chopping wood and carrying water necessitate significant core engagement to maintain balance and control movement. This strengthens the core musculature, contributing not only to improved posture but also to enhanced performance in other physical activities, mirroring the functional strength developed by individuals engaged in manual labor.

  • Postural Integrity

    Full-body engagement inherent in functional movements promotes proper postural alignment. Activities like chopping wood and carrying water encourage an upright posture, strengthening the muscles responsible for maintaining spinal stability. This contributes to improved posture over time, mitigating the risks of back pain and other postural issues often associated with sedentary lifestyles and isolated muscle training.

  • Increased Caloric Expenditure

    Engaging multiple muscle groups simultaneously increases caloric expenditure both during and after activity. The body requires more energy to fuel the coordinated effort of multiple muscle groups, leading to a greater metabolic demand compared to isolated exercises. This contributes to improved body composition and overall fitness, aligning with the principles of achieving desired physical results through consistent, functional movement.

These facets of full-body engagement highlight its significance in achieving holistic fitness. The interconnectedness of muscle groups emphasized by activities like chopping wood and carrying water builds a resilient and functionally strong physique. This approach extends beyond aesthetics, focusing on cultivating a body capable of meeting the demands of everyday life with strength, efficiency, and resilience.

7. Improved Posture

Improved posture stands as a significant outcome and reinforcing component of the functional fitness approach exemplified by the “chop wood, carry water” analogy. The physical demands inherent in activities like chopping wood and carrying water necessitate proper postural alignment for efficient force production and injury prevention. Regular engagement in these activities strengthens the core musculature, crucial for maintaining an upright posture. The repeated act of swinging an axe, for instance, strengthens the back muscles responsible for spinal extension, counteracting the tendency towards rounded shoulders often associated with sedentary lifestyles. Similarly, carrying heavy loads necessitates core engagement to stabilize the spine and maintain balance, fostering a stronger and more stable posture. This cause-and-effect relationship between functional movement and postural improvement contributes significantly to the desired physical adaptations associated with this approach.

The importance of improved posture extends beyond aesthetics. Proper postural alignment optimizes respiratory function, allowing for greater oxygen intake and improved cardiovascular efficiency. It also reduces stress on joints and ligaments, mitigating the risk of pain and injury. Consider the difference between a farmer with a strong, upright posture and an office worker with a slumped posture. The farmer, accustomed to physical labor, often exhibits greater resilience to back pain and other musculoskeletal issues. This illustrates the practical significance of improved posture as a component of overall physical well-being. Furthermore, improved posture can positively influence self-perception and confidence. Standing tall with shoulders back projects an image of strength and vitality, potentially contributing to improved self-esteem and a more positive body image.

Integrating postural awareness into daily life reinforces the benefits of functional movement. Practicing mindful attention to posture during everyday activities, such as sitting, standing, and walking, reinforces the gains achieved through activities like chopping wood and carrying water. Addressing postural imbalances through targeted exercises, such as yoga or Pilates, further enhances postural integrity and complements the functional strength developed through natural movement patterns. While achieving and maintaining optimal posture requires ongoing effort and awareness, the benefits extend far beyond physical appearance, contributing to improved physical function, reduced pain, and enhanced overall well-being. This holistic approach to posture aligns with the broader philosophy of functional fitness, emphasizing the interconnectedness of physical and mental well-being.

Practical Tips for Implementing Functional Fitness Principles

These practical tips provide actionable strategies for incorporating the principles of functional fitness into daily life, promoting sustainable physical adaptations and overall well-being. Each tip reflects the essence of “chop wood, carry water,” emphasizing consistent, natural movement.

Tip 1: Prioritize Compound Movements
Focus on exercises engaging multiple muscle groups simultaneously, such as squats, lunges, push-ups, and rows. These compound movements mimic natural movement patterns and build functional strength applicable to everyday activities. Consider incorporating bodyweight exercises or utilizing readily available resources like resistance bands or free weights.

Tip 2: Integrate Movement into Daily Life
Seek opportunities for physical activity throughout the day. Choose walking or cycling instead of driving short distances, take the stairs instead of the elevator, or engage in active hobbies like gardening or dancing. These small changes cumulatively contribute to significant increases in physical activity levels.

Tip 3: Emphasize Proper Form
Maintaining correct form during any physical activity is crucial for maximizing benefits and minimizing the risk of injury. Focus on proper alignment, controlled movements, and engaging the appropriate muscle groups. Consider seeking guidance from a qualified movement specialist to ensure proper technique.

Tip 4: Listen to the Body
Pay attention to physical cues and respect limitations. Avoid pushing through pain or excessive fatigue, which can lead to injury and setbacks. Gradual progression and adequate rest are essential for sustainable progress. Rest and recovery are integral components of any fitness regimen.

Tip 5: Cultivate Mindful Movement
Engage in physical activity with present moment awareness. Focus on the sensations of movement, the rhythm of breathing, and the connection between mind and body. This mindful approach enhances the overall experience and fosters a deeper appreciation for physical activity.

Tip 6: Find Enjoyable Activities
Long-term adherence to physical activity depends significantly on enjoyment. Experiment with various activities to discover those that resonate with individual preferences and values. Engaging in activities that provide intrinsic satisfaction increases motivation and promotes consistency.

Tip 7: Prioritize Consistency Over Intensity
Regular, moderate-intensity activity yields greater long-term benefits than sporadic bursts of intense exertion. Focus on establishing a sustainable routine of physical activity that can be maintained consistently over time.

Tip 8: Embrace the Process
Physical transformation is a journey, not a destination. Focus on making gradual, sustainable changes and celebrating small victories along the way. This long-term perspective fosters patience, resilience, and a lifelong commitment to physical well-being.
